5 Benefits of Partnering with a Known Brand

Partnering With A Brand

Whether you are a startup or an established business, you always have the option to partner with known brands to increase your sales potential. You may carry your own brand products but as a lesser known entity, these may not sell as quickly as you’d like. In business, it’s all about establishing brand and the reputation that goes with it, so why not partner with known brands that consumers have come to trust? If you are looking to grow your business, one of the quickest and most effective ways to do so is to partner with known brands. The following six benefits should explain why.

1. Riding the Waves

One of the reasons why so many startups begin as partners or resellers is because of what is often termed as ‘riding the waves.’ Just as a surfer catches the big one and rides it out, so too do new businesses find that one brand they can partner with, that ‘big one’ that will make them clearly visible in a sea of competitors. For example, partnering with a telecommunications company like Cisco enables you to ride the waves of their reputation for excellence in products and services. As a startup you can develop your own area of expertise within the telecommunications niche, such as video conferencing, but Cisco partners gain credibility simply by joining forces with such a globally renowned name in the industry – a name that is synonymous with setting industry standards.

2. Greater Access to Product Information

When becoming a partner with a known brand, you have greater access to product information. What many new businesses might not understand is that partnering is steps above being a retail reseller. A partner is trained in the products they carry, has access to product information and tech support and typically the backing of the brand they are partnering with. Not financial, of course, but rather tips and techniques that set their products apart from the competition and quick ‘fixes’ if a bit of product information is the only thing needed to satisfy the customer. Established brands have Product Information Management (PIM) systems in place you can take advantage of in most cases and that saves time and money while helping to establish your company as an expert in the field.

3. Greater Networking Potential

When partnering with a known brand you also have greater potential to network with other people and professionals within your industry. Sometimes there are forums and message boards you can join, even on the company’s website. Other times you can run searches on social sites like LinkedIn to find people like yourself in the industry dealing with the same, or like, products. Networking is one of the best ways to grow your business because it puts you in touch with other professionals and potential customers who you can engage with on a more personal level. You can ask and answer questions, bringing your company into the spotlight, especially with the search engines! You’d be surprised at just how many of those questions you are active in are SEO topics that bring in huge amounts of traffic.

4. Enhanced Marketing Potential

Speaking of SEO, partnering with a known brand also offers greater marketing potential. Many of the brands you can partner with have their own ads for partners to utilize. These are much cheaper than producing your own marketing and advertising strategies and many times the ads you can use are absolutely free to partners. The brand you partner with knows what works within their industry and this offers you extremely enhanced marketing potential because you can draw on what has and has not worked for that particular brand.

6. Long Term Stability

When choosing a known brand to partner with, you will of course want to choose one with a long history of success. This, in itself, offers your startup an opportunity for long term stability within your market. Those products have been on the market for a long time, the brand you partner with is well respected, and there is every reason to believe they will be around a very long time yet to come. When choosing that brand to partner with, you are ensuring the availability of products you can offer now in the immediate future and in the long term as well.

Starting a new business or growing a small, lesser known company, can take years to achieve any sort of success. However, when partnering with a major brand that has already reached the pinnacle of success you can quite literally ride the waves of that success. These are just a few of the benefits you should be aware of when deciding whether or not to strike it out alone or partner with known brands. If you are looking for quick growth, partnering is probably your best bet.
